http://zimmer.csufresno.edu/~johnca/ppqa5.htm WebApr 4, 2013 · Scenario #1: A five-member board; it takes a majority of “yes” votes to pass: two members vote “yes”. two members vote “no”. one abstains. Result: the matter does not pass because the abstention does not count as a vote and there was not a majority in …

WebYes, according to Robert, in this situation the count is 3 votes in favor and one against. “Abstain” is not a vote. Three votes are a majority of four, so the motion passes. Some … WebJan 19, 2024 · In some cases, an assembly will have a rule prescribing a different threshold for adoption (e.g. a majority of members present, a majority of all members). In those circumstances, an abstention may have the same effect as a no vote, but that still does not mean that an abstention is a no vote. See FAQ #6 for more information.
